Article Chemistry, Physical

Complex interplay between colloidal stability, transport, chemical reactivity and magnetic separability of polyelectrolyte-functionalized nanoscale zero-valent iron particles (nZVI) toward their environmental engineering application

Wei Ming Ng et al.

Summary: The dual reactive and magnetic functionalities of nanoscale zero-valent iron (nZVI) make it a highly studied nanomaterial for environmental engineering. However, the agglomeration of nZVI due to magnetic interaction results in poor colloidal stability and reduced reactivity. Surface functionalization with polyelectrolyte is proposed as a solution to improve stability. This paper discusses the impact of surface functionalization on the performance of nZVI and highlights challenges in its application.

Article Chemistry, Multidisciplinary

Sulfidized Nanoscale Zero-Valent Iron: Tuning the Properties of This Complex Material for Efficient Groundwater Remediation

Jiang Xu et al.

Summary: Sulfidized NZVI (SNZVI) has emerged as a promising material for groundwater remediation, expanding the range of reactive contaminants and significantly improving selectivity and reactive lifetime. SNZVI, a complex mixture of reactive metallic iron and iron sulfides, has desirable properties compared to traditional NZVI. Research is now focusing on understanding the factors influencing SNZVI reactivity and tuning synthesis conditions to control sulfur speciation for tailored reactivity towards specific groundwater contaminants.
